How should I share code when I lack the karma to attach it?

Actually, I want to ask a question about the behavior of a Lua dissector, but I think this is only sensible with attaching the dissector (2 files, 1908 lines total), and I need more karma to do that. So, this question is: Are there recommended ways (possibly beneficial for the community) to collect the needed karma in a reasonable time (of course I wouldn't want to spend a long time before I can ask the actual question), or is there another solution to my problem?

The command practise is to upload them somewhere else and then link it in your question.

E.g. a public file share. Unfortunately this is required otherwise spammers will abuse the "free" upload option.

Karma is obtained by activity on this site, thus "proving" you're not a spammer.

You could post the files to the wireshark-dev mailing list, along with your questions about them.
